簡體   English   中英

如何在 Android Ui 中使用資產?

[英]How to use an asset in Android Ui?

我是 Android Studio 的新手。 在前端工作時,有時很容易將某些部分作為 png 文件並將其放在特定的 position 上,而不是在 xml 文件中重新創建它。 我很困惑我們可以一直使用 png 嗎? 我擔心 memory 空間。 就像該應用程序包含 50 個頁面,並且在每個頁面中我使用 1-2 個資源。 我不希望我的應用程序超過 40mb。 最好的方法是什么? 我們可以將圖像存儲為 URL 並在我們使用時檢索它。 這種方式有什么缺點?

這么多的問題:)

我很困惑我們可以一直使用 png 嗎?

使用最適合您的照片的東西。 對於照片,JPEG 可能會做得更好。 但是,如果您願意,您可以一直使用 PNG,是的。

我不希望我的應用程序超過 40mb。

檢查並查看。 取決於您的圖像有多大; 我們不能說。

最好的方法是什么?

沒有足夠的信息來告訴你。 一般來說,在資產中使用圖像並沒有錯。

我們可以將圖像存儲為 URL 並在我們使用時檢索它。

是的。

這種方式有什么缺點?

您需要在某處獲得一些服務器空間。 此外,還會有加載延遲。 此外,您的應用程序在與 Internet 斷開連接時將無法使用。

在前端工作時,有時很容易將某些部分作為 png 文件並將其放在特定的 position 上,而不是在 xml 文件中重新創建它。

這就是讓我感到困惑的部分。 Android XML 布局通常包含交互元素,用戶可以與之交互。 另一方面,圖像往往是 static。 您認為可以用圖像替換哪種 XML?

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M